That message, across multiple devices, looks like its coming from your Internet Service Provider and nothing to do with your equipment. It could be because the sites you're trying to reach have an invalid certificate or other anomaly. You need to contact your ISP. To confirm, go to a McDonald's or library and try access. Or turn off the wireless on your iPhone and try connecting via your cell phone service..thereby bypassing your ISP. One long shot is that your home router got reconfigured - many more sophisticated devices allow "blocking" of IP ranges or whole domains - this doesn't sound likely though if you didn't do it...
